Mechanical Engineer - Electric Vehicle

Expected activity, deliverables, accountability

Design & Planning:

  • Translate product requirements into a high-level motorcycle concept and detailed specifications across different engineering streams.
  • Define timeline, milestones, and deliverables for all streams (entire assembly, sub-assembly, parts, and components).
  • Evaluate and analyze engineering calculations on simulation software, draft configuration settings, and assess the manufacturability of prototype design.
  • Key deliverables include Detailed Engineering Design (DED).
  • Generate styling options that are aligned with product requirements, target market segment, and brand identity

Prototyping:

  • Converting DED to technical drawing, creating a playbook that includes fabrication work instructions and component-level quality checking.
  • Create assembly and subassembly playbook
  • Work with procurement team to source components and raw materials
  • Monitor and quality checking: check if fabrication matches engineering specs.
  • Execute component-level quality checking, implement root-cause analysis of No-GO component, generate deviation report, and update fabrication work instructions
  • Assembling each component to sub-assemblies and sub-assemblies to the entire assembly
  • Deliver motorcycle prototype and technical specifications of motorcycle prototype
  • Prototype evaluation, engineering correction, and troubleshooting
  • Review technical specs and quality checks based on DED and technical regulations related to motorcycle systems
  • Designing, reviewing, and executing a series of engineering tests for reliability, manufacturability, and riding experience (dynamics, human-machine interaction, interface, etc.)
  • Engineering correction and troubleshooting. Review prototype evaluation and generate a report of any corrective and preventive action necessary to discuss with the product lifecycle management team
  • Design for production: collecting all related engineering data, playbook, and reports.
  • Work with the manufacturing engineering team to generate updated DED, drawings, and instructions to be used for manufacturing purposes
